Just adhere to the following actions to redo certification in doc:

  1. Make sure your internet connection is strong and open a web browser.
  2. Go to DocHub and create or access your existing account. You can also use your Google profile to make it even faster.
  3. As soon as you're in, click New Document and import it from your device, external URL, or cloud.
  4. The editor will open, and you can redo certification in doc, adding new elements and replacing existing ones.
  5. Save your updates. Click Download/Export to save your updated file on your device or to the cloud.
  6. Send your forms. Decide how you want to share it: as an email attachment, a Sign Request, or a shareable link.

My certification expired. What happens now? If your certification expires, you must earn the certification again by passing the required exam(s).
Theres no cost to renew your Certification, and you can take the online renewal assessment as many times as you needjust make sure that you pass the assessment before your Certification expires.
Fundamentals certifications do not expire. You can take the renewal assessment any time during your six-month eligibility window, via Microsoft Learn. Once you pass, your certification will be extended one year from the expiration date.
What is certification renewal? How do I renew my certification? docHub certifications expire after two years. You can renew your certification by taking and passing the latest version of the applicable docHub certification exam.
Please keep in mind that once a Certification expires, the candidates will not be able to take the renewal assessment and the Certification must be achieved again, by scheduling and passing the exam(s) required for it, as first-time earners would.
Microsoft role-based (associate and expert) and specialty Certifications are valid for one (1) year from the date that you complete all requirements to earn that Certification. To prevent your Certification from expiring you must renew the Certification before the Certification expiration date.
